<?php
declare (strict_types=1);
namespace Rector\CodeQuality\Rector\FunctionLike;
use PhpParser\Node;
use PhpParser\Node\Expr\Array_;
use PhpParser\Node\Expr\Assign;
use PhpParser\Node\Expr\AssignOp;
use PhpParser\Node\Expr\Variable;
use PhpParser\Node\Stmt;
use PhpParser\Node\Stmt\Expression;
use PhpParser\Node\Stmt\Return_;
use PHPStan\Type\MixedType;
use Rector\CodeQuality\NodeAnalyzer\ReturnAnalyzer;
use Rector\Core\Contract\PhpParser\Node\StmtsAwareInterface;
use Rector\Core\NodeAnalyzer\ExprAnalyzer;
use Rector\Core\NodeAnalyzer\VariableAnalyzer;
use Rector\Core\NodeManipulator\ArrayManipulator;
use Rector\Core\PhpParser\Node\AssignAndBinaryMap;
use Rector\Core\Rector\AbstractRector;
use Rector\DeadCode\NodeAnalyzer\ExprUsedInNodeAnalyzer;
use Symplify\RuleDocGenerator\ValueObject\CodeSample\CodeSample;
use Symplify\RuleDocGenerator\ValueObject\RuleDefinition;
/**
* @see \Rector\Tests\CodeQuality\Rector\FunctionLike\SimplifyUselessLastVariableAssignRector\SimplifyUselessLastVariableAssignRectorTest
*/
final class SimplifyUselessLastVariableAssignRector extends AbstractRector
{
/**
* @readonly
* @var \Rector\Core\PhpParser\Node\AssignAndBinaryMap
*/
private $assignAndBinaryMap;
/**
* @readonly
* @var \Rector\Core\NodeAnalyzer\VariableAnalyzer
*/
private $variableAnalyzer;
/**
* @readonly
* @var \Rector\CodeQuality\NodeAnalyzer\ReturnAnalyzer
*/
private $returnAnalyzer;
/**
* @readonly
* @var \Rector\DeadCode\NodeAnalyzer\ExprUsedInNodeAnalyzer
*/
private $exprUsedInNodeAnalyzer;
/**
* @readonly
* @var \Rector\Core\NodeManipulator\ArrayManipulator
*/
private $arrayManipulator;
/**
* @readonly
* @var \Rector\Core\NodeAnalyzer\ExprAnalyzer
*/
private $exprAnalyzer;
public function __construct(AssignAndBinaryMap $assignAndBinaryMap, VariableAnalyzer $variableAnalyzer, ReturnAnalyzer $returnAnalyzer, ExprUsedInNodeAnalyzer $exprUsedInNodeAnalyzer, ArrayManipulator $arrayManipulator, ExprAnalyzer $exprAnalyzer)
{
$this->assignAndBinaryMap = $assignAndBinaryMap;
$this->variableAnalyzer = $variableAnalyzer;
$this->returnAnalyzer = $returnAnalyzer;
$this->exprUsedInNodeAnalyzer = $exprUsedInNodeAnalyzer;
$this->arrayManipulator = $arrayManipulator;
$this->exprAnalyzer = $exprAnalyzer;
}
public function getRuleDefinition() : RuleDefinition
{
return new RuleDefinition('Removes the latest useless variable assigns before a variable will return.', [new CodeSample(<<<'CODE_SAMPLE'
function ($b) {
$a = true;
if ($b === 1) {
return $b;
}
return $a;
};
CODE_SAMPLE
, <<<'CODE_SAMPLE'
function ($b) {
if ($b === 1) {
return $b;
}
return true;
};
CODE_SAMPLE
)]);
}
/**
* @return array<class-string<Node>>
*/
public function getNodeTypes() : array
{
return [StmtsAwareInterface::class];
}
/**
* @param StmtsAwareInterface $node
*/
public function refactor(Node $node) : ?Node
{
$stmts = $node->stmts;
if ($stmts === null) {
return null;
}
foreach ($stmts as $stmt) {
if (!$stmt instanceof Return_) {
continue;
}
if ($this->shouldSkip($stmt)) {
return null;
}
$assignStmt = $this->getLatestVariableAssignment($stmts, $stmt);
if (!$assignStmt instanceof Expression) {
return null;
}
if ($this->shouldSkipOnAssignStmt($assignStmt)) {
return null;
}
if ($this->isAssigmentUseless($stmts, $assignStmt, $stmt)) {
return null;
}
$assign = $assignStmt->expr;
if (!$assign instanceof Assign && !$assign instanceof AssignOp) {
return null;
}
$this->removeNode($assignStmt);
return $this->processSimplifyUselessVariable($node, $stmt, $assign);
}
return null;
}
private function shouldSkip(Return_ $return) : bool
{
$variable = $return->expr;
if (!$variable instanceof Variable) {
return \true;
}
if ($this->returnAnalyzer->hasByRefReturn($return)) {
return \true;
}
if ($this->variableAnalyzer->isStaticOrGlobal($variable)) {
return \true;
}
if ($this->variableAnalyzer->isUsedByReference($variable)) {
return \true;
}
$phpDocInfo = $this->phpDocInfoFactory->createFromNodeOrEmpty($return);
return !$phpDocInfo->getVarType() instanceof MixedType;
}
/**
* @param Stmt[] $stmts
*/
private function getLatestVariableAssignment(array $stmts, Return_ $return) : ?Expression
{
$returnVariable = $return->expr;
if (!$returnVariable instanceof Variable) {
return null;
}
//Search for the latest variable assigment
foreach (\array_reverse($stmts) as $stmt) {
if (!$stmt instanceof Expression) {
continue;
}
$assignNode = $stmt->expr;
if (!$assignNode instanceof Assign && !$assignNode instanceof AssignOp) {
continue;
}
$currentVariableNode = $assignNode->var;
if (!$currentVariableNode instanceof Variable) {
continue;
}
if ($this->nodeNameResolver->areNamesEqual($returnVariable, $currentVariableNode)) {
return $stmt;
}
}
return null;
}
private function shouldSkipOnAssignStmt(Expression $expression) : bool
{
if ($this->hasSomeComment($expression)) {
return \true;
}
$assign = $expression->expr;
if (!$assign instanceof Assign && !$assign instanceof AssignOp) {
return \true;
}
$variable = $assign->var;
if (!$variable instanceof Variable) {
return \true;
}
$value = $assign->expr;
if ($this->exprAnalyzer->isDynamicExpr($value)) {
return \true;
}
return $value instanceof Array_ && $this->arrayManipulator->isDynamicArray($value);
}
private function hasSomeComment(Expression $expression) : bool
{
if ($expression->getComments() !== []) {
return \true;
}
return $expression->getDocComment() !== null;
}
/**
* @param Stmt[] $stmts
*/
private function isAssigmentUseless(array $stmts, Expression $expression, Return_ $return) : bool
{
$assign = $expression->expr;
if (!$assign instanceof Assign && !$assign instanceof AssignOp) {
return \false;
}
$variable = $assign->var;
if (!$variable instanceof Variable) {
return \false;
}
$nodesInRange = $this->getNodesInRange($stmts, $expression, $return);
if ($nodesInRange === null) {
return \false;
}
//Find the variable usage
$variableUsageNodes = $this->betterNodeFinder->find($nodesInRange, function (Node $node) use($variable) : bool {
return $this->exprUsedInNodeAnalyzer->isUsed($node, $variable);
});
//Should be exactly used 2 times (assignment + return)
return \count($variableUsageNodes) !== 2;
}
/**
* @param Stmt[] $stmts
* @return Stmt[]|null
*/
private function getNodesInRange(array $stmts, Expression $expression, Return_ $return) : ?array
{
$resultStmts = [];
$wasStarted = \false;
foreach ($stmts as $stmt) {
if ($stmt === $expression) {
$wasStarted = \true;
}
if ($wasStarted) {
$resultStmts[] = $stmt;
}
if ($stmt === $return) {
return $resultStmts;
}
}
if ($wasStarted) {
// This should not happen, if you land here check your given parameter
return null;
}
return $resultStmts;
}
/**
* @param \PhpParser\Node\Expr\Assign|\PhpParser\Node\Expr\AssignOp $assign
*/
private function processSimplifyUselessVariable(StmtsAwareInterface $stmtsAware, Return_ $return, $assign) : ?StmtsAwareInterface
{
if (!$assign instanceof Assign) {
$binaryClass = $this->assignAndBinaryMap->getAlternative($assign);
if ($binaryClass === null) {
return null;
}
$return->expr = new $binaryClass($assign->var, $assign->expr);
} else {
$return->expr = $assign->expr;
}
return $stmtsAware;
}
}
